Solution Overview
Problem
Existing gaming machines with mechanical movable devices can only present pre-fixed bonus awards and are limited to specific slot machines, unable to dynamically change bonus content or operate remotely across different games.
Innovation Solution
A gaming machine system featuring a slot machine, a bonus device, and a device controller that allows for remote operation of bonus devices, enabling dynamic bonus content determination and presentation independent of the slot machine's game results, with the ability to collect wagers, determine bonus amounts, and transmit bonus information across multiple devices.

Data Source
AI summary
The present invention provides a gaming machine that includes a slot machine, a bonus device and a device controller. The device controller remotely operates the bonus device and the bonus device provides a bonus award independently from the slot machine. The bonus device describes a bonus display information upon receiving from the device controller with a condition independent from a game result of the slot machine. Also, the device controller can collect a wager from one or more slot machines, determine a bonus content based on the collected wager, remotely operate one or more bonus devices, and transmit same or different bonus display information for each bonus device.
